Transcription profiling of Rhesus monkey extraocular muscle and its layers


ABSTRACT: Rhesus monkey extraocular muscle. Data set includes: (a) whole medial and lateral rectus muscle and (b) global and orbital muscle layers separately microdissected using a Leica LSM. All samples were expression profiled here using the Affymetrix human U133 A&B arrays. Data form part of publication: Investigative Ophthalmology and Visual Science 45 (in press), 2004.

ORGANISM(S): Macaca mulatta

Genome-wide transcriptional profiles are consistent with functional specialization of the extraocular muscle layers.

Khanna Sangeeta S   Cheng Georgiana G   Gong Bendi B   Mustari Michael J MJ   Porter John D JD  

Investigative ophthalmology & visual science 20040901 9


<h4>Purpose</h4>Compartmentalization of the extraocular muscles into well-defined orbital and global layers is highly conserved. Recently, the active pulley hypothesis correlated the anatomic properties of orbital-global muscle layers with layer-specific division of labor.
